Trump-linked WLFI burns $1.43M worth of tokens after $1M buyback
Trump-backed WLFI has burned $1.43 million in tokens after a $1.06 million buyback funded by DeFi fees, with another 3.06 million tokens remain unburned.
World Liberty Financial (WLFI), the President Donald Trump-affiliated decentralized finance project, has burned 7.89 million WLFI tokens, worth approximately $1.43 million, following a $1.06 million buyback across different chains.
Onchain data gathered by Lookonchain shows the project collected 4.91 million WLFI ($1.01 million) and $1.06 million in fees and liquidity earnings from its DeFi activities, and spent $1.06 million to repurchase 6.04 million WLFI on the open market.
The team later burned 7.89 million WLFI on BNB Smart Chain (BNB) and Ethereum (ETH), while 3.06 million WLFI ($638,000) remains unburned on Solana (SOL) pending further actions.
